Using Enlarge/Reduce Key

AUTO
sets the DCP to calculate the ratio that fits the size of your paper.
ZOOM
allows you to enter a ratio from 25% to 400% in 1% increments.

Place the original face up in the ADF, or face down on the scanner glass.
2
Use the numeric keys to enter the number of copies you want (up to 99).
3
Press Enlarge/Reduce. (Enlargement or reduction ratios appear.)

Poster copies require using the scanner glass.
When selecting an enlargement or reduction ratio, you will need to know the
size of the paper you registered in Menu 1-1.
